§ 5.20.020 EXCLUSIONS.
   (A)   Except as may be otherwise specifically provided in this section, the terms of this section shall not be deemed or construed to apply to any of the following persons:
      (1)   Any public utility which pays to the town a tax under a franchise or similar agreement or any publicly-owned public utility;
      (2)   Banks, including national banking associations, to the extent that a city may not levy a license tax upon them under the provisions of Art. XIII, § 27, of the state’s Constitution;
      (3)   Insurance companies and associations, to the extent that a city may not levy a license tax upon them under the provisions of Art. XIII, § 28, of the state’s Constitution; and
      (4)   Any person whom the town is not authorized to license under any law or constitution of the United States or the state.
   (B)   The Town Clerk may require the filing of a verified statement from any person claiming to be excluded by the provisions of this section, which statement shall set forth all facts upon which the exclusion is claimed.
